There are good looking boy bands, and there is the Red Hot Chili Peppers.

There are good looking boy bands, and there is the Red Hot Chili Peppers. They've been around the block, but they are still going strong. I, however, prefer their Blood Sugar Sex Magik era - both musically and for style. The RHCP have always had style, from Anthony Kiedis' ever-evolving hair styles to Flea's elaborate costumes (remember the stuffed animal pants?!). I swoon for guys that are both musical and aren't afraid to dress in...

chain mail skirts, glitter lipstick, mirrored pants, metallic Doc Martens and devil horns. These are the wardrobe choices for their part glam rock, part tribal music video of 1991. The groundbreaking video, directed by Stéphane Sednaou, broke conventions with its intense, sporadic energy and aforementioned get ups. Shot in black and white, the band members were spray painted gold - though they appear to be silver. My favorite outfit in the video? The nominations for this year's American Music Awards are out!

The nominations for this year's American Music Awards are out! Carmen and Tyrese announced the nominees for the awards which will be in LA on November 21st. What's cool about these awards is that the nominations were determined by record sales and radio air play but the winners are determined by the public. Here's more:

Mariah Carey, the Red Hot Chili Peppers, The Black Eyed Peas and Nickelback lead the nominations with three nods each. Carey, a nine-time American Music Award winner, was nominated for Favorite Female Artist in both the Pop/Rock and Soul/Rhythm & Blues categories as well as Favorite Album in the Soul/Rhythm & Blues category for "The Emancipation of Mimi." The Red Hot Chili Peppers received Pop/Rock nominations for Favorite Band, Duo or Group and Favorite Album for "Stadium Arcadium" along with a nod for Favorite Artist in the Alternative Music Category. Hip/Hop Funk sensation The Black Eyed Peas are up for Favorite Band, Duo or Group and Favorite Album for "Monkey Business" in the Rap/Hip Hop category along with a nomination in the Soul/Rhythm & Blues category for Favorite Band, Duo or Group. Nickelback's hit album "All the Right Reasons" helped earn them three American Music Award nominations. The group is up for Favorite Album and Favorite Band, Duo or Group in the Pop/Rock category and will compete against the Red Hot Chili Peppers and Pearl Jam for Favorite Artist in the Alternative Music category.
